High feed costs remain a major constraint in the cultivation of Asian seabass (Lates calcarifer) in floating net cages (FNC), necessitating a more efficient feeding strategy without compromising fish growth performance. This study aims to analyze the effect of a combination of commercial feed and lemuru fish (Sardinella longiceps) on the feed efficiency and growth of Asian seabass, as well as to determine the most optimal feed combination. The research employed an experimental method utilizing a Randomized Block Design (RBD) consisting of three treatments and three replications: Treatment A (100% commercial feed), Treatment B (75% commercial feed + 25% lemuru fish), and Treatment C (50% commercial feed + 50% lemuru fish). The observed parameters included absolute length growth, absolute weight growth, specific growth rate (SGR), feed conversion ratio (FCR), survival rate (SR), and water quality. Data were analyzed using Analysis of Variance (ANOVA) at a 95% confidence level, followed by the Least Significant Difference (LSD) test. The results indicated that the feed combinations significantly affected growth and feed efficiency (p < 0.05). Treatment B yielded the best performance with an absolute length growth of 5.07 cm, an absolute weight growth of 50.5 g, an SGR of 2.225% per day, and the lowest FCR of 1.877 g/g. The fish survival rate ranged from 90% to 93%, while water quality parameters remained within the optimal range throughout the study. Therefore, the combination of 75% commercial feed and 25% lemuru fish is the most effective formulation for improving the feed efficiency and growth of Asian seabass in the floating net cage system.

Goldfish is a fish commodity whose demand continues to increase every year by ornamental fish lovers because of its beautiful color. However, the color fading of goldfish causes the market price of goldfish to decline. This research aims to analyze the effect of adding kepok banana peel extract (Musa paradisiaca) on the brightness of goldfish (Carassius auratus). The method used in this research was a Completely Randomized Design (CRD) with 4 treatments and 3 replications. Where P1 (Without the addition of Kepok banana peel extract), P2 (Kepok banana peel extract 10 ml/kg feed), P3 (Kepok banana peel extract 20 ml/kg feed), and P4 (Kepok banana peel extract 30 ml/kg feed). The results of the research on the level of fish color brightness were obtained in the P3 treatment with a dose of 20 ml/kg feed and the best absolute weight growth was in P4 with a weight increase of 0.84 g, the best absolute length growth was obtained in P4 with a result of 0.99 cm, and the growth rate the best daily was at P4 with a growth rate of 0.69%. The results of the highest feed conversion ratio were found in P4, namely 21.60. Meanwhile, the best survival was found in P1 and P3 with a percentage of 100%.

Empowering coastal communities is an important strategy for improving the productivity and welfare of traditional fishermen. This study aims to formulate a model for empowering traditional fishermen that integrates technological modernization and institutional strengthening in North Lombok Regency. A Research and Development (R&D) approach was used, with data collected through surveys, interviews, focus group discussions, field observations, and documentation studies. The analysis was conducted descriptively for quantitative data and through data reduction techniques for qualitative data. The results show that modern technology is still rarely used, while fishermen's awareness and interest in adopting it are very high but hampered by capital constraints. On the institutional side, most fishermen are members of groups, but the functions of these organizations are not yet optimal in terms of capital, training, and collective marketing. Based on these findings, the study produced an empowerment model based on three pillars, namely technological modernization, institutional strengthening, and ecosystem support through access to capital, regulations, and multi-stakeholder partnerships. This model is expected to be a realistic and sustainable implementation framework to improve the productivity and welfare of traditional fishermen in the future.

Port waters are coastal areas vulnerable to environmental pressure due to shipping activities, coastal settlements, and beach utilization. This study aimed to identify total coliform bacteria in the waters of Lembar Port and compare the results with the applicable seawater quality standard. The study was conducted from August to September 2025 at five sampling stations representing different activity zones, namely Lembar Port dock, Gili Mas dock, ship parking area, Cemare Beach, and a control area. Seawater samples were collected purposively at a depth of 10–20 cm and analyzed in the laboratory using the Most Probable Number (MPN) method. Temperature and pH were measured as supporting parameters, while data on ship activity and community sanitation were used as contextual information. The results showed that all sampling stations had total coliform values of <1.8 MPN/100 mL. These values were far below the seawater quality standard of 1,000 MPN/100 mL. Water temperature ranged from 29 to 30.7°C, while pH ranged from 7.71 to 8.19. Ship traffic remained active during the study period, but it was not followed by an increase in measurable total coliform. Limited interviews also indicated that households in the surrounding villages had toilets with septic tanks. Therefore, the microbiological quality of Lembar Port waters during the observation period still met the seawater quality standard for total coliform and may serve as baseline data for future port water quality monitoring.

Pangandaran has significant capture fisheries potential; however, fresh fish is highly perishable, requiring processing to increase its value. One prominent processed product is salted jambal roti fish, which plays an important role in the coastal economy. This study aims to analyze value added, technical production performance, and economic feasibility of processing businesses in Fish Processing and Marketing Groups (Poklahsar) in Pangandaran Village. The methods used include Hayami value-added analysis, cost-benefit analysis, and technical evaluation based on GMP, SSOP, and HACCP standards. The results show that the value added generated is Rp7,937.5/kg with a ratio of 19.8%, categorized as moderate. Economically, the business is feasible, with a profit of Rp1,235,069 per production cycle, profitability of 15.44%, and a Benefit-Cost Ratio of 1.18. The payback period is 0.23 years, with a break-even point of 12.95 kg and a unit production cost of Rp67,649/kg. However, technical performance remains low, with only 47% compliance with GMP, SSOP, and HACCP standards. In conclusion, the salted fish processing business is economically viable but requires improvements in technical practices and food safety systems to ensure sustainability.

Freshwater bawal (Colossoma macropomum) is a high-value fishery commodity, widely consumed due to its rapid growth and meat quality. However, bawal seeds sized 2-3 cm face high mortality rates, often influenced by stocking density. This study aims to determine the optimal stocking density to maximize the survival rate of these seeds. The research was conducted over 14 days (January 10–24, 2026) using an experimental method with a Completely Randomized Design (CRD), consisting of five treatments and five replications. The treatments involved different stocking densities: A (5 fish/L), B (15 fish/L), C (25 fish/L), D (35 fish/L), and E (45 fish/L). The specimens were fed commercial pellets three times daily. Data were analyzed using one-way ANOVA followed by an HSD (Honestly Significant Difference) test at a 5% significance level. The results indicate that stocking density significantly affects the survival rate. Treatment A (5 fish/L) yielded the highest survival rate at 98.0%. Water quality remained stable throughout the study, with temperatures at 27.5–27.9°C, dissolved oxygen at 3.8–4.0 ppm, and pH at 7.5–7.8.

This study aims to analyze the level of efficiency of pond aquaculture enterprises and to identify the factors that influence the efficiency of pond farming businesses in Tani Baru Village, Anggana District. This study employed a survey method using purposive sampling to determine respondents based on the Slovin formula. Data were analyzed using the Data Envelopment Analysis (DEA) method with the Constant Return to Scale (CCR) and Variable Return to Scale (BCC) models,and the factors influencing efficiency were analyzed using Tobit regression analysis. The results showed that the average efficiency values in the CCR model were Technical Efficiency (TE) of 0.067, Allocative Efficiency (AE) of 0.693, and Cost Efficiency (CE) of 0.031. Meanwhile, in the BCC model, the results obtained were Technical Efficiency (TE) of 0.152, Allocative Efficiency (AE) of 0.642, and Cost Efficiency (CE) of 0.092. The results of the Tobit regression analysis indicated that business experience and land area had a significant effect on the efficiency of pond aquaculture businesses, whereas age and education did not have a significant effect.

The development of ornamental fish in Indonesia is increasing, especially for freshwater ornamental fish. One of the freshwater ornamental fish that is in great demand by the people today is the guppy fish (Poecilia reticulata). Water fleas (Daphnia sp) is one type of natural food consumed by freshwater fish species. Feeding fish seed is an important factor that must be considered. The purpose of this study was to determine the optimal dose of natural feed Daphnia sp for the absolute growth weight of seeds guppy fish (Poecilia reticulata) within 5 — 45 days. This study used an experimental method with complete random design consist of 5 experiments and 5 repetitions. Treatment A uses a dose of 4%, B; 6%, C ; 8%, D ; 10% and E ; 12%. The test animals were guppy fish seeds from 5-45 days old with an average weight of 0,2 g/tail. The stocking density of guppy is 3 fish/lt and the experimental media used fresh water with a volume of 3 lt/tub. The results showed that experiment C giving the highest average on the growth of guppy weight on the aged of 5-45 days with a height of 0,94 g/tail. The water quality data during the study obtained water temperatures range from 27.2°C – 27.9°C, acidity levels range from 7,3 - 7,8 and dissolved oxygen range from 5,2 - 5,7 ppm.
